Eldad and two Hope for Paws team members attended Lisa Ashe’s funeral.

It was then that they learned about eight abandoned puppies. In remembrance of Lisa’s passion for animals, the team decided to save the young ones. It was impossible to find the mother, and the puppies were living in a cave. In order to get the puppies out, the team used a cheeseburger. The team was only able to locate six puppies at first.

A puppy eventually approached the rescuer and was placed in a crate. However, something had scared the other puppies in the meantime. Everyone else hid inside the cave as a result. Eldad was forced to rely solely on his gentle snare since he was unable to get any closer. The third and fourth puppies were rescued after the second puppy was rescued.It was also possible to save the infants in a similar manner. Puppies had never been touched by humans before, so they were terrified.

Each puppy’s crate was secured. The remaining infants, however, were difficult to save. The kids had walked further back through a deep, narrow tunnel about six feet north and twelve feet west. Eldad and the others dug a tunnel to get to where they were. A cave collapse could end the rescue mission, so they had to exercise caution. As soon as the women removed Eldad and the puppies, Eldad climbed into the cave and picked up each puppy one by one.

Despite their exhaustion after saving seven puppies, the rescuers still had one more to save. Having rescued the last puppy, Eldad entered the cave to see if there were any more puppies. Fortunately, the ninth puppy was also saved. The puppies were kept together at the rescuers’ facility. The following day, they met Olive, their surrogate mother. Each puppy was named Lisa M. Ashe. Their names were Luke, Isaac, Sarah, Abraham, Mary, Angel, Solomon, Heaven, and Ezekiel.
